The Complete Guide to NAD+ Therapy in 2026

NAD+, short for Nicotinamide Adenine Dinucleotide, is one of the most important molecules in the human body. It functions as a coenzyme in hundreds of metabolic reactions, powers cellular energy production, supports DNA repair mechanisms, and regulates proteins that control inflammation and aging. The problem is that our bodies produce less and less of it as we get older. By the time most people reach their 40s, NAD+ levels have declined by as much as 50 percent compared to younger years. This decline is directly tied to the fatigue, mental fog, slower recovery, and reduced metabolic efficiency that many adults begin experiencing in midlife.

Why NAD+ Levels Matter

At the cellular level, NAD+ is involved in converting nutrients into usable energy through a process called oxidative phosphorylation. It is also a key substrate for a family of proteins called sirtuins, which regulate gene expression, stress responses, and cellular longevity. When NAD+ is abundant, sirtuins are active, cells repair themselves efficiently, and mitochondria function at a high level. When NAD+ is depleted, these processes slow down. Research published in leading journals has linked low NAD+ levels to accelerated cellular aging, cognitive decline, metabolic dysfunction, and reduced immune resilience.

Boosting NAD+ through supplementation is not a new concept. Scientists and physicians have explored precursors like NMN (nicotinamide mononucleotide) and NR (nicotinamide riboside) for years. However, injectable and nasal spray formulations that deliver NAD+ more directly into the system have emerged as a faster, more bioavailable option. Understanding NAD+ Delivery Methods

One of the first decisions you will face when starting NAD+ therapy is how you want to receive it. The two most common methods available through online providers are subcutaneous injection and nasal spray. Each has distinct advantages and tradeoffs.

Subcutaneous injection is widely considered the gold standard for NAD+ delivery. The compound enters the bloodstream efficiently, bypassing digestive processing that would otherwise degrade it. Most users report faster and more pronounced results with injections. The process is straightforward: a small needle is used to inject a measured dose just beneath the skin, typically in the abdomen or thigh. Providers supply all necessary supplies and provide detailed instructions.

Nasal spray is a needle-free alternative that appeals to patients who are uncomfortable with self-injection. While the absorption rate is somewhat lower compared to injection, nasal spray still delivers a meaningful dose of NAD+ and is far more convenient for on-the-go use. Who Should Consider NAD+ Therapy

NAD+ therapy is not limited to any one type of person, but certain groups tend to experience the most noticeable benefits. Adults over 35 who have noticed a gradual decline in energy, focus, or physical recovery are the most common candidates. Executives and professionals dealing with high cognitive demands often report that NAD+ therapy helps them sustain sharper mental performance throughout the day. Athletes and fitness-focused individuals use it to support faster recovery from training. Those managing metabolic conditions or seeking comprehensive preventive health strategies may also find it valuable as part of a broader wellness protocol.

It is important to note that NAD+ therapy is not a replacement for foundational health practices. A consistent sleep schedule, nutrient-dense diet, regular physical activity, and stress management are all foundational. NAD+ therapy works best as a complement to these habits, amplifying their effects by supporting the cellular machinery that underlies everything your body does.
